Output 143417ded26e383c1e99d3b6cd34c9d020b083b089834c4ebde3b70fbccbbfa3:22

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ab85a2601ff2dac8242b00ae6f08c8eda2cbe1ba OP_EQUAL
address
A85CJGLXbjkJYWQeWzQ6PQfjzDrvPfRguv
transaction
143417ded26e383c1e99d3b6cd34c9d020b083b089834c4ebde3b70fbccbbfa3